Answer:
The details in this passage send the message that nonviolent resistance is an important tool in the fight for positive change.
Explanation:
From the first sentence, you can see the speaker brought up the examples of peaceful nonviolent resistance movements led by Martin Luther King Jr. and how they were successful in helping the black people of the time defeat racial injustice.
The speaker also mentioned how effective their first boycott was in eliminating the insecticides from their first contracts with the grape growers.
